Bar is a mill product form that is processed by forging or rolling and heat treated to ordered dimensions and required metallurgical and mechanical properties. Bars are rounds of less than 4" diameter and / or shaped cross section profiles (flats, squares, rectangles) of similar dimension.
A billet can also be many shapes including round, square, round cornered square, rectangle, octagon, etc. RTI's billets are typically forged in an open die press or GFM and are always thermal mechanically processed to the final ordered dimensions and required metallurgical and mechanical properties.

Plates are smooth, flat, and of uniform thickness between 0.1875" and 4.00". RTI has the ability to produce master plates in both standard sizes and custom sized master plates of specific thickness, width and length. RTI also saw cuts and water jet cuts plates to custom sizes and profiles.
A smooth, flat product uniform thickness of less than 0.1875" produced in both standard and custom width and length. Sheet is also available as cut to size per customer request.
A flat product produced via cold rolling into coils. Titanium "strip" is typically available in CP titanium grades, but not most highly alloyed grades.
